Key Features to Look For in a Senior-Friendly TableWhen selecting an air hockey table for older adults, prioritizing specific design features ensures safety, comfort, and longevity. The first consideration is height and stability. Traditional arcade tables can be heavy and permanent, while flimsy tabletop models might slide around during intense play. A sturdy, mid-sized standalone table with leg levelers provides the necessary stability, ensuring the surface remains perfectly flat and safe to lean against occasionally. Look for tables that offer a comfortable playing height, typically around 30 to 32 inches, to prevent excessive bending and back strain.Another crucial factor is the scoring system and puck visibility. High-contrast pucks—such as bright red or neon green against a white or light-grey playfield—make tracking much easier for individuals with age-related vision changes. While digital scoreboards with sound effects add an exciting arcade feel, large, manual sliding scorers are highly reliable and easy to read without relying on complex electronics. Additionally, a powerful but quiet blower motor is essential; it keeps the puck gliding smoothly while ensuring the background noise remains at a comfortable level for conversation.

Top Affordable Options Under Three Hundred DollarsBringing the excitement of air hockey home does not require a massive financial investment. The market now features several budget-friendly options that deliver high-quality performance without the commercial price tag. For those with limited space, a premium 40-inch to 48-inch tabletop model is an excellent choice. These compact units can be placed securely on an existing dining table or kitchen island, providing a robust playing experience, and can be easily stored in a closet or under a bed when the grandchildren visit.If space permits a standalone option, 5-foot to 6-foot folding or lightweight recreation tables offer incredible value. Many manufacturers now design these mid-sized tables with foldable legs and built-in wheels, allowing a single person to roll the table into a corner after use. These models typically feature reinforced legs for added stability and reliable 110V blower motors that plug directly into standard wall outlets. By opting for these residential-grade, mid-sized options rather than heavy-duty arcade replicas, buyers enjoy the full game experience while keeping expenses low.

Health Benefits and Cognitive StimulationThe health benefits of regular air hockey play extend far beyond basic physical movement. Medical experts frequently emphasize the importance of tracking exercises for cognitive longevity. The unpredictable, rapid bounces of an air hockey puck force the brain to make split-second calculations, predicting angles and reacting to defensive moves. This type of active mental engagement helps maintain neural pathways associated with processing speed and executive function, serving as an enjoyable shield against cognitive decline.From a physical perspective, the game promotes gentle cardiovascular health. A fifteen-minute match gets the heart pumping and encourages deep breathing, all while the player is distracted by the fun of competition. It also exercises the wrist, elbow, and shoulder joints, helping to maintain flexibility and combat stiffness caused by arthritis. Because players remain on their feet and shift their weight from side to side, air hockey naturally enhances balance and core stability, which are vital components in preventing accidental falls in daily life.
